How the VAT calculation works

To add VAT, multiply the VAT-exclusive price by the VAT rate, then add that VAT amount to the original price.

To remove VAT from an inclusive price, divide the total by one plus the VAT rate. The difference is the VAT amount.

Frequently asked questions

Can this remove VAT from a VAT-inclusive price?

Yes. Choose VAT-inclusive and the calculator will split the total into the net price and VAT amount.

Can I use a custom VAT rate?

Yes. The calculator defaults to 20%, but you can enter another rate for countries, reduced rates or special scenarios.

Is VAT the same as Australian GST?

They are similar consumption taxes, but rules and rates differ by country. This page is a general calculator, not tax advice.
